Did you know that most kitchen sponges are made from plastics and acrylics that shed micro-plastics into our water ways and ocean?
These sponges are made of 100% natural vegetable cellulose, unlike the plastic and pesticide ridden sponges that traditionally fill supermarkets. Don't let this fool you though, as they're durable and last just as long as conventional sponges.
Because they're shipped dehydrated, they significantly reduce packaging waste and transportation emissions. After their lifecycle they can also be fully composted instead of having to be incinerated or buried underground.
Coconut Husk, Cellulose (natural wood pulp)

The Environmental Problem
Traditional green and yellow plastic sponges are made with toxic chemicals and pesticides such as triclosan, which causes health issues and destroys fragile ecosystems.
Unfortunately, water treatment systems can’t remove it so they persist for very long periods of time in our environment.
